Beschreibung

This book examines how different forms of proximity influence the knowledge processes necessary for sustainable innovation. Exploring five key dimensions—geographical, cognitive, institutional, organizational, and social—it shows how the most effective combinations of these dimensions support strong, sustainability-oriented innovation networks.

Through an analysis of how these dimensions interact, the book identifies common patterns in successful collaborations. It provides practical guidance for companies, policymakers, universities, and civil society organizations designing innovation networks or selecting partners for collaborative projects. Policy actors will find guidance for crafting strategies that promote sustainability more effectively.

At its core, the book introduces a refined analytical framework for studying multiactor settings, which are typical of sustainable innovation. It addresses the complexity of sustainability challenges and the dispersed, context-specific knowledge they require. Drawing on innovation systems research and sustainability science, the book provides a deeper understanding of how sustainable innovations take shape and thrive.
